We're Hiring - Accounting Technician Position!

This role is on-site at our Yarmouth, Nova Scotia office. While remote work may be possible down the road, this position requires being in person for now. 


Compensation and Perks:

Compensation:  

  • Starting Pay: $21/hour
  • Top Rate: $25/hour
  • Growth Path: We have a clear, transparent progression matrix that rewards skill, initiative, and quality of work. Strong performers who demonstrate independence, accuracy, and client focus can fast-track to the top rate.
     

We believe in paying for talent and results. This role is designed for someone who wants to take ownership of their work, contribute to improving processes, and grow with the company. Your pay reflects both your experience and the value you bring to our team.

Benefits: 

  • One extra week of paid vacation annually, sick time, and bonuses.
  • Flexible working hours because we believe work-life balance isn’t just a nice idea, it’s a necessity.


Hours:  This is a full-time, permanent role (30–40 hours/week) with a flexible schedule. The position is currently onsite in Yarmouth, NS, but we are exploring remote options for the future. 

Timeline: As soon as possible. We will continue accepting applications until the right person is found.

About The Gig:

 

We’re looking for an experienced Accounting Technician who is already strong in Canadian bookkeeping, CRA reviews, and T1/T2 preparation. You won’t need us to teach you the work, you’ll bring that expertise. We’ll train you on our systems and processes so you can help us make them even better.


You will:

  • Own day-to-day bookkeeping for multiple small business clients (accruals, AR/AP, bank/credit card reconciliations, monthly closes).
  • Prepare and file T1 returns and prepare T2 returns for filing with a quality-first mindset; ensure compliance and defend positions when needed.
  • Handle CRA correspondence/reviews end-to-end: assemble support, draft responses, track deadlines, and communicate with clients.
  • Prepare working papers and year-end files that other pros can follow easily.
  • Communicate directly with clients (email, phone, occasional in-person) to clarify issues, explain results, and set expectations.
  • Identify process gaps and propose improvements—templates, checklists, automations, and controls that reduce error and rework.

First 90 days—what success looks like:

  • Master our workflow (workpapers, file naming, review steps, practice management) and hit consistent weekly targets.
  • Clean, review-ready files with clear notes
  • Proactively raise risks and suggest at least 1 tangible process improvement. 
  • Earn client trust through clear, kind, timely communication.

Must-haves

  • 2–5+ years in an accounting technician/bookkeeping role serving Canadian small businesses.
  • Hands-on with CRA reviews/audits and drafting response letters with supporting schedules. 
  • Proficient preparing T1 and T2 returns 
  • Proficient preparing Payroll, sales tax (HST) filings, and year-end support experience.
  • Strong working papers discipline and attention to detail; you balance speed with accuracy.
  • Client-facing confidence: you can ask precise questions, translate accounting into plain language, and follow through.
  • Self-directed and accountable. You take ownership and communicate early.
  • Comfortable with common accounting tech: Sage, QuickBooks Online, Xero, Excel/Google Sheets; ability to learn new tools quickly.


Nice-to-haves

  • Experience standardizing processes (checklists, SOPs) and improving close timelines
  • Working knowledge of firm practice tools (e.g., Dext/Hubdoc, Plooto, Wagepoint, Practice/Workflow apps).
